猿编程需要什么

fiy 其他 25

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    猿编程需要什么?

    猿编程是指人类通过编写计算机程序来实现特定功能的技术。要成为一名优秀的猿编程,需要掌握一些基本的知识和技能。下面是一些你需要具备的东西:

    1.编程语言的基本知识:猿编程的核心是掌握一门或多门编程语言。比如,C++、Java、Python等。你需要了解这些语言的语法、数据类型、变量、条件语句、循环语句等基本概念。

    2.算法和数据结构:编写高效的程序需要掌握算法和数据结构。你需要学习如何分析和解决问题,如何设计和实现数据结构,以及如何使用适当的算法来处理数据。

    3.软件开发工具:为了提高编程效率,你需要掌握一些软件开发工具,比如集成开发环境(IDE)、文本编辑器、版本控制工具等。

    4.逻辑思维和解决问题的能力:编程需要具备良好的逻辑思维能力,能够分析和解决问题。你需要学习如何将复杂的问题分解为简单的步骤,并找到合适的解决方案。

    5.不断学习的精神:编程是一个不断学习的过程,技术发展迅速,你需要保持学习的热情。阅读相关的书籍和文档,参加培训和研讨会,与其他开发人员交流经验,都是提高编程能力的有效途径。

    总之,猿编程需要基本的编程知识、算法和数据结构、软件开发工具、逻辑思维和解决问题的能力,以及不断学习的精神。如果你对这些方面感兴趣并且愿意付出努力,那么你就可以成为一名优秀的猿编程。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    猿编程需要以下几点:

    1.编程语言知识:猿编程首先要掌握至少一门编程语言,比如Java、Python、C++等。不同的编程语言有不同的特点和应用场景,掌握多种编程语言能够使猿编程者更加灵活地解决问题。

    2.算法和数据结构:对于猿编程来说,算法和数据结构是基础中的基础。猿编程者需要深入理解各种常见的数据结构(如数组、链表、栈、队列等)以及常见的算法(如排序、查找、图算法等),并能够运用它们来解决实际问题。

    3.问题解决能力:猿编程者需要具备良好的问题解决能力,能够分析和理解问题的本质,找出解决问题的思路和方法,并将其转化为计算机程序。这需要对问题领域的专业知识有一定的理解,以及丰富的实践经验。

    4.团队合作能力:猿编程者往往需要与其他猿编程者一起协作完成项目。因此,良好的团队合作能力对于猿编程来说也非常重要。猿编程者需要能够与他人沟通协调,能够分工合作,能够理解和尊重他人的观点,并能够在团队中高效地协作完成项目。

    5.持续学习能力:猿编程是一个快速发展的领域,新的技术和工具层出不穷。因此,猿编程者需要具备持续学习的能力,跟上行业的最新趋势和技术变革。同时,猿编程者还需要善于自我学习,能够独立地解决遇到的新问题,并不断提升自己的技术能力。

    总之,猿编程需要一定的技术基础和专业知识,但更重要的是对问题的分析和解决能力以及团队合作能力。不断学习和提升自己的能力也是猿编程者必备的品质。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    猿编程需要具备以下几个方面的要素:

    1. 扎实的编程基础知识:作为一个程序员,首先要掌握编程语言的基本语法、数据结构和算法等基础知识。无论是C、C++、Python、Java还是其他编程语言,都需要熟练掌握其语法规则和常用的编程技巧。

    2. 解决问题的能力:编程的目的是解决问题,因此需要具备较强的问题分析和解决能力。能够理解需求,确定问题的核心,然后运用合适的算法和数据结构来实现解决方案。

    3. 学习能力和持续学习的意愿:编程的世界发展迅速,新的技术和工具不断涌现。作为一个程序员,需要具备持续学习的意愿和能力,不断了解行业的新动态和学习新的技术知识,保持自身的竞争力。

    4. 逻辑思维和抽象能力:编程需要具备较强的逻辑思维和抽象能力。能够将问题抽象为逻辑结构,分析和设计程序的运行流程,理清楚整体的思路和步骤。

    5. 团队合作和沟通能力:在一些大型项目中,通常需要与其他开发人员、设计师以及项目经理等紧密合作。因此,具备良好的团队合作和沟通能力是必不可少的。

    6. 解决bug的能力:在编程过程中,难免会遇到各种各样的bug。猿编程需要具备排查和解决bug的能力,能够快速定位和修复代码中的问题。

    7. 创新和思维的灵活性:编程中需要有创新的思维和灵活的思维方式,能够用不同的思路解决问题,提供创新的解决方案。

    总之,猿编程需要具备扎实的编程基础,解决问题的能力,持续学习的意愿,逻辑思维和抽象能力,团队合作和沟通能力,解决bug的能力,以及创新和思维的灵活性。只有具备了这些要素,才能在编程的道路上不断成长和进步。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部